SB 2612·TN·senate

Professions and Occupations - As introduced, decreases from 30 to 21 days the time in which a licensed polygraph examiner or company must notify the commissioner of commerce and insurance of a change in business address. - Amends TCA Title 4; Title 62 and Title 63.

Summary

The bill changes Tennessee law so that any polygraph examiner or company with a state license must inform the commissioner of commerce and insurance in writing within 21 days after moving or changing its business address, instead of the previous 30‑day period. It applies to all currently licensed polygraph professionals and firms. The change is meant to ensure the state receives address updates more promptly.
